During the annual "Year in Review" press conference, Russian President Vladimir Putin, responding to a question about support for young families, noted the tradition of early marriages in the North Caucasus. He said he believed this was "right" and suggested "following their example," citing Ramzan Kadyrov's large family.
A court in Makhachkala arrested blogger Khadzhimurad Khanov for two months. Before this, the head of Dagestan, Sergei Melikov, criticized him and promised him consequences due to a recent incident involving him.
Earlier, Khadzhimurad Khanov publicly demanded an apology from a doctor from Khasavyurt after a story with a patient in a niqab. At the reception, the doctor asked a woman in closed Muslim clothing to undress, to which she refused. The story became public, and threats and insults were showered on the doctor.
Officially, Khanov was arrested in a criminal case for illegal possession of weapons. Before his arrest, he recorded a video in which he stated a possible provocation. The man connected what was happening with his criticism of the doctor from Khasavyurt. At the same time, he noted that he wanted to eliminate the conflict on national and religious grounds as much as possible.
